Muscat – The Ministry of Housing and Urban Planning (MHUP) announced that Phase 1 of the integrated service stations on the Batinah Expressway was opened in the wilayat of Liwa on Sunday.
In a statement, MHUP said that in the first phase, only the primary service of fuel stations have been provided, with more facilities to open in due course.
In January, MHUP had announced that it would complete the works of the integrated service stations on Batinah Expressway within 2022.
According to the ministry, the stations are distributed over four locations in North Batinah governorate, with an area ranging from 15,000 sqm to 30,000 sqm. Two integrated service stations will be in Al Hoor region in the wilayat of Suwaiq, one in Rawdha in the wilayat of Saham and the fourth station in New Liwa District in the wilayat of Liwa.
The ministry confirmed that the integrated service stations comprise a fuel station, public utility building with restaurants, multiservice trade outlets, hotel suite, park, prayer areas for men and women, parking lots and other services.
